The Association is an independent, nonpartisan conservation organization created in 1944 to represent the interests of the 96 local soil and water conservation districts and the 492 district supervisors who direct their local district's conservation programs. 



The Association's objectives are to:

bullet

Promote soil and water conservation through its member Districts, cooperating agencies and organizations, and the media

bullet

Represent the interests of member Districts in the creation, cultivation and full realization of locally led conservation programs with state and federal agencies, interested organizations and the public

bullet

Coordinate the work of local Districts for the common interests of all Districts
